Causes of wrinkles under the eyes

Many homemade masks are versatile: put sour cream on your face to refresh your skin, mix honey with an egg to nourish it. The situation is completely different with products designed to care for the skin around the eyes. This area of ​​the face differs from all other areas in its structure, so not all products are suitable for removing wrinkles from it. Having found out why this is where the first alarming signs of aging appear, you can prevent their occurrence in time. Some reasons are due to physiological factors beyond the woman’s control, while others are due to improper care:

  • In this area of ​​the face there are no sebaceous glands that would moisturize the skin, so gradual dehydration (loss of moisture) leads to the formation of unpleasant folds;
  • There are tiny muscles around the eyes that reflect every emotion that a person experiences: hence the inevitable facial wrinkles that no one can avoid;
  • Over time, cells lose the ability to produce compounds important for skin elasticity, such as elastin and collagen - as a result, folds, bags, and networks of small, radial wrinkles form;
  • Without additional protection, this area of ​​the face is the first to suffer from adverse atmospheric phenomena (heat, frost, snow, winds, ultraviolet radiation, etc.), which injure the sensitive, thin, delicate skin around the eyes: therefore, it is recommended to use all kinds of protective masks;
  • Abuse of decorative cosmetics actively contributes to the removal of moisture from cells, and the skin begins to age and wrinkle;
  • Staying near a computer for a long time is another indirect reason that can trigger the appearance of folds in this area of ​​the face;
  • A disrupted daily routine (chronic lack of sleep) also ultimately leads to the first wrinkles under the eyes appearing in twenty-year-old girls;
  • Improper nutrition does not provide the body with the substances it needs - the skin also does not receive enough of them, the result is sagging and folds.

The structural features of the skin around the eyes force us to be more attentive and careful about this part of the face. Basic rules of care (using nourishing masks, cleansing the skin of cosmetics by washing your face every day before bed) help prolong youth and prevent the early appearance of wrinkles. You also need to forget about long sitting at the computer after midnight and daily fast food with soda in order to get your appearance in order.

Rules for using anti-wrinkle masks

The special structure of the skin around the eyes requires the competent use of prescription masks. This will enhance their effectiveness.

  1. If there are no wrinkles, there is no need to prematurely suffer from what has not yet happened and use these remedies as a preventive measure. Choose any others - nourishing or simply moisturizing, but without a lifting effect. Otherwise, the result will be exactly the opposite.
  2. Masks for wrinkles under the eyes exclude any experiments with recipes. If it is indicated that you need to use sour cream to prepare it, please use this particular product, and not kefir, yogurt or yogurt.
  3. If you can find homemade eggs and dairy products to prepare the mask, the effectiveness of the mask will increase several times.
  4. To deeply moisturize this area of ​​the face, use dairy products with the highest fat content.
  5. Pre-check the prepared mixtures for allergy: lubricate your wrist with a small amount, rinse after 15 minutes and observe the reaction for 3-4 hours. The absence of itching and rashes is an indication that the mask can be applied to the sensitive area near the eyes.
  6. Before application, thoroughly clean eyelids and eyelashes of cosmetics.
  7. It is recommended to apply with light tapping movements with your fingertips, as if “driving” the product into the skin.
  8. While the mask is in effect, it is not recommended to walk around the house, do anything, or show emotions. It is better to lie on your back with your eyes open, relax, and think about good things.
  9. Be careful not to get the mixture into your eyes, otherwise any of the ingredients may irritate them and cause them to become very red.
  10. Do not keep these masks on for longer than 15 minutes. The optimal time is ten minutes.
  11. Rinse off with water at room temperature or with a cotton pad soaked in a decoction of herbs.
  12. Regularity is the key to the effectiveness of any mask. Therefore, do not forget to do them a couple of times a week after a bath or shower before bed.
  13. Change the composition of the masks so as not to cause your skin to become addicted to the same ingredients. If you've been using one recipe for a month, it's time to use another. Then, if necessary, you can return to the old one.

Nasolabial folds have become more pronounced

Over time, not only the skin ages, but also the ligamentous apparatus, as well as subcutaneous fat. Because of this, nasolabial folds become more noticeable after 30 years. The foundation begins to settle into the wrinkles, and they are emphasized even more.

Recommendations from a cosmetologist: you can cope with this sign of skin aging with facial massage (you can try the popular LPG), self-massage at home, as well as biorevitalization. A more radical method is contour plastic surgery (injection of hyaluronic acid-based gel into the area of ​​the nasolabial folds).

Dark circles and puffiness under the eyes

Lack of sleep, stress, overwork, working at the computer and on the phone give us dark circles and puffiness under the eyes. A healthy lifestyle helps reduce these manifestations of skin aging: walks in the fresh air, seven hours of sleep (you need to go to bed no later than 23 hours), giving up bad habits.

Recommendations from a cosmetologist: a cream with vitamin C and caffeine will work well in home care. A potato mask containing catechins will help prevent swelling. If all these methods do not give effect, or you want to get the result faster, contour plastic surgery and mesotherapy come to the rescue.
